Hair Fashion

If there is one thing that most little girls are concerned about it is hair fashion. This usually starts around age ten or twelve in earnest, and will probably last a life time. Our hair is something that can be changed time and time again because it keeps growing out, though it does that faster for some than for others. I have been the exception, and I do not know if it is a blessing or a curse. I have naturally curly hair, so that means that my options are not nearly what people with straight hair have. Though my selections are limited, it also means that I do not have to worry about it as much as others seem to.

If you have naturally curly hair like I do, you already know your choices for hair fashion are limited. However, if you really want something new, you should find someone who specializes in your type of hair. Naturally curly hair is nothing like straight hair. There is just no comparison. It is harder to manage, harder to care for, and the styles for hair fashion are limited. However, there are many out there that know what they are doing, and they can usually find something amazing to do with your hair. You just have to find the right person. Call around and ask.

Those with straight hair have a wide open field when it comes to hair fashion. They can do almost anything they want as long as they find a good stylist to cut their hair for them. The choices are never limited, but there are trends that many like to stick to. Even someone who does not like to follow trends will generally find something that is trendy, and then have it cut to their specifications. The problem is choosing and knowing what will look best with your face shape.

One of the best places to find the latest hair fashion styles is to look at those who cut hair for a living. They probably have the latest cuts on their heads. This can give you an idea of what is popular and even what is about to catch on. The best thing about hair fashion is that a simple cut will look different on each person. Talk with a qualified stylist about what you want to do with your hair, and ask them if they think it is a good idea. They often know what would look good for you.

In addition, hair salons have style books you can look through to get ideas. These styles are often too way out for every day life, but you can get some good ideas. Lastly, you can use the old standby of providing a picture of the style you want. Look through magazines. Often, there will be a movie star or two that has a style you like and can wear. Don't forget to take physical characteristics into consideration. Consider your hair type, head size and face shape, along with your current hair length. Even with these minor limitations, it is easier for a stylist to understand what you what by looking at a photograph or other printed sample, rather than by a verbal description. Often, too much gets lost in the translation, and when it comes to your style considerations, communication with your stylist is key.
